Switched around FSU's again.
19Year old Valeo only works on low speeds. (Was like that for 6years of owning car before i decided to replace fsu)
1week old Meyle burned up & stopped working on all speeds.
2week old eBay special didn't burn & stopped working on all speeds randomly one startup. Worked fine when ignition was turned off at service station. Turned ignition on, Kaput, dead, Rip.
I de-potted the Valeo tonight, re-soldered the fet legs. Will see if it works on high & low fan speeds. If so, I'll put my replacement chinese special in for another 1-2weeks.
All wiring good, fuse good, relay good, correct voltages being output from the IHKA.
Looks like I have to pull the dash to replace an in theory "power hungry" blower motor.

If you don't care to do it properly, sure.
I see the metal is bulging outward, so at the very least you're going to want to knock down the high points. The body shop would do this by welding on a small peg at the middle of the gash then yanking on it with a slide-hammer. Then grind off the peg.
Then they would do a skim of Bondo, more sanding, and spray.
If you want to DIY, Harbor Freight sells a stud welder for $100, and then sand/prep/spray with a color-matched aerosol (like those available from AutomotiveTouchUp.com) and finish with a 2-part aerosol clear coat.
This sheetmetal is extremely tough. I've had a couple of accidents in E39s, one directly in this area, and the body shop mentioned how tough this area was. A photo from their repair work showed more than 40 (!) spot welds in the rocker panel.
